Call for Participants for Competition Model Advisory Panel

Posted by Jo Lim on 6 July 2000

.au Domain Administration invites people with an interest in the .au namespace to nominate for a position on the Competition Model Advisory Panel.  The panel is to review existing .au operations, overseas best practice, and recommend a model for the introduction of competition in the provision of domain name services in .au.

The panel membership will be structured to represent all areas of the Australian community including consumers, domain name end users, and the internet industry.

Note that there is a significant amount of work to be carried out, and the estimated timeframe to complete all the Panel’s work is approximately 10-12 months.  Nominees should confirm that they can make the significant time commitments necessary as panel members, and should read:

Nominees who are not appointed to the Panel will have ample opportunity to participate through the Panel’s public consultation processes, including making submissions to the Panel, and participating in the email discussion list.
